On the evening of Sept. 1, two archery hunters shot and killed a large adult male grizzly bear in self-defense while hunting for elk west of Island Park Reservoir.

On Aug. 31, after consulting with the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service, Idaho Fish and Game trapped and euthanized two, 1 ½ year old grizzly bears in the Squirrel area east of Ashton.
